MoveOn88 is important impact on the political landscape. Since its establishment in 1997, MoveOn88 evolved into a prominent force for progress. Its supporters organize in multiple campaigns, including online engagement https://ammarxnxv739894.myparisblog.com/38662899/mobilize88-mobilizing-for-change